Over the past decade, the gambling industry has undergone a profound transformation. The advent of online platforms has revolutionised the way players access games, compete, and engage with operators. According to industry reports, the global online gambling market is projected to surpass €100 billion in revenue by 2025, driven by increasing smartphone penetration, improved internet connectivity, and evolving consumer preferences.[1] However, with this rapid growth comes an imperative need for security, transparency, and trust—cornerstones that define credible online gambling operators in today’s digital landscape.
The success of an online casino hinges on its ability to foster trust and provide secure experiences. Players entrust sensitive personal and financial data, expecting stringent safeguards against fraud and hacking. This trust is especially critical given the regulatory environment governing online gambling, where licensing authorities like the UK Gambling Commission enforce rigorous standards.
Among the vital elements of security is the user authentication process—a gateway that ensures only legitimate users access their accounts and sensitive information. A robust, user-friendly login portal not only enhances customer confidence but also acts as a deterrent against unauthorised access.
An effective online casino platform must incorporate a highly secure login system—serving as the initial line of defence against cyber threats. Such portals typically employ multi-factor authentication, encryption protocols, and biometric verification to safeguard user credentials.
Industry leaders invest heavily in developing seamless yet secure login experiences. For example, integrating encrypted sessions ensures that data transmitted between user devices and servers remains confidential. Additionally, anomaly detection algorithms monitor for suspicious login activities, alerting users to potential breaches.

| Feature | Multi-Factor Authentication | Biometric Verification | One-Time Passwords (OTP) |
|---|---|---|---|
| Security Level | High | Very High | Moderate |
| User Convenience | Moderate | High | High |
| Implementation Cost | Moderate | High | Low |
The future of online casino security will increasingly leverage emerging technologies, including artificial intelligence, advanced encryption, and decentralised identity verification. Moreover, regulatory frameworks are evolving to mandate higher standards—making secure login portals non-negotiable for licensed operators.
